What Causes Acid Erosion?

Acid erosion occurs when acidic substances wear away tooth enamel. This can be caused by dietary habits, health conditions, and even dental hygiene practices. Unlike cavities, acid erosion results from direct acid exposure rather than bacterial decay.


Common Causes Include:

  • Acidic Foods and Drinks – Frequent consumption of soda, citrus fruits, and sports drinks.
  • Gastroesophageal Reflux (GERD) – Stomach acid that enters the mouth can damage enamel.
  • Dry Mouth – Reduced saliva leads to less natural protection against acids.
  • Overbrushing – Brushing too aggressively or immediately after eating acidic foods can worsen erosion.


How to Prevent Acid Erosion

  1. Adjust Your Diet
    Limit acidic foods and drinks. After consuming them, rinse with water to neutralize acid levels.
  2. Fluoride Protection
    Fluoride strengthens enamel and helps prevent erosion. Ask about fluoride treatments during your visit to the
    best family dentist in La Plata, MD for added protection.
  3. Stay Hydrated
    Drinking water throughout the day promotes saliva production, which helps wash away acids and food particles.
  4. Brush Gently
    Use a soft-bristled toothbrush and wait 30 minutes after eating before brushing to avoid brushing softened enamel.


Restorative Treatments for Acid Erosion

If acid erosion has already damaged your teeth, Cieplak Dental Excellence offers advanced restorative solutions:

  • Dental Crowns and Bonding – Protect and restore teeth that have experienced significant enamel loss.
  • Veneers – Enhance the appearance of eroded teeth with durable, natural-looking veneers from a cosmetic dentist in La Plata, MD.
  • Fillings and Sealants – Sealants and fillings repair small areas of erosion and prevent further damage.
